An adult client who is hospitalized after surgery reports
sudden onset of chest pain and dyspnea. the client
appears anxious, restless, and mildly cyanotic. the nurse
should further assess the client for which condition? -
Answer-Pulmonary embolism


which information should the nurse obtain when
performing an initial assessment of a client who presents
to the emergency department with a painful ankle injury?
(select all that apply) - Answer-Quality of the pain
Signs of inflammation
Ankle range of motion
Visible deformities of the joint


Which description of pain is consistent with a diagnosis of
rheumatoid arthritis? - Answer-Joint pain is worse in the
morning and involves symmetric joints

Which physical assessment finding should the nurse
anticipate in a client with long-term
gastroesophagealreflux disease (GERD)? - Answer-
Hoarseness


A client presents with chronic venous insufficiency. Which
assessment finding should the nurse anticipate? - Answer-
Bilateral lower leg stasis dermatitis


A client has been hospitalized with a femur fracture and is
being treated with traction. which action by the nurse is the
priority when caring for this client? - Answer-Assess
neurovascular status


Which statement made by a client with chronic pancreatitis
indicates that further education is needed? - Answer-I will
cut back on smoking cigarettes daily


The nurse is teaching a female client who uses a
contraceptive diaphragm about reducing the risk for toxic
shock syndrome (TSS). Which information should the
nurse include? (Select all that apply) - Answer-Do not
leave the diaphragm in place longer than 8 hours after
intercourse

Replace the old diaphragm every 3 months


A male client who smokes two packs of cigarettes a day
states he understands that smoking cigarettes is
contributing to the difficulty that he and his wife are having
in getting pregnant and wants to know if other factors
could be contributing to their difficulty. Which information is
best for the nurse to provide? (Select all that apply). -
Answer-Alcohol consumption can cause erectile
dysfunction


Low testosterone levels affect sperm production


Cessation of smoking improves general health and fertility


Twenty four hours after a client returns from surgical
gastric bypass, the registered nurse (RN) observes large
amounts of blood in the nasogastric tube (NGT) cannister.
Which assessment finding should the RN report as early
signs of hypovolemic shock? - Answer-lethargy

the registered nurse (RN) is assessing a male client who
arrives at the clinic with severe abdominal cramping, pain,
tenesmus, and dehydration. the RN discovers that the
client has had 14 to 20 loose stools with rectal bleeding.
When taking the client's medical history, which information
is most for the nurse to obtain? - Answer-Ulcerative colitis


A client is newly diagnosed with diverticulosis. The
registered nurse (RN) is assessing the client's basic
knowledge about the disease process. Which statement
by the client conveys an understanding of the etiology of
diverticula? - Answer-Chronic constipation causes
weakening of colon wall which results in out pouching
sacs


The registered nurse (RN) is assessing a client who was
discharged home after management of chronic
hypertension. Which equipment should the RN instruct the
client to use at home? - Answer-Sphygmomanometer
